Abuja – The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) says its is partnering Teenz Global
Foundation (TGF), an NGO, on the enlightenment of youths and teenagers.
The commission, in its daily bulletin issued on Wednesday in Abuja, said that the partnership was to ensure that teenagers and youths had appreciable understanding of the electoral process.
The bulletin quoted the INEC Director of Voter Education and Publicity, Mr Oluwole Osaze-Uzzi, as saying that the partnership was demonstrated through a quiz competition on voter education organised by the commission in Abuja.
“When children are properly and adequately groomed at the early days of their lives, they grow to become better citizens.”
Osaze-Uzzi, who was represented at the occasion by the Deputy Director, Civil Society Organisations (CSOs) Liaison, Mrs Rose Anthony-Orarian, lauded the initiative of the NGO and expressed optimism that Nigeria would be great with such platform.
“With such platform where young people are encouraged to appreciate the importance of education, Nigeria’s cultural heritage and their role as citizens of this great country, our society will be better for it.’’
In her remarks, the Project Manager of TGF, Ms Gloria Onyekwere, said that the programme was intended to harness peaceful values in various Nigerian cultures and to promote peaceful co-existence among teenagers, using indigenous languages. (NAN)
